Chegg Q2 revenue falls 51%
CHGG•Outlook
Chegg sees Q3 total net revenues between $43 million and $44 million. The company expects Q3 gross margin in the range of 48% to 49%, and Q3 adjusted EBITDA between $1 million and $2 million.
Business trends
- Expense reduction - The company nearly halved non-GAAP operating expenses year over year, citing disciplined management and AI-driven productivity gains.
- Skilling business - Chegg Skilling revenues rose 2% year over year, with new distribution partnerships expected to contribute more meaningfully later this year.
- Academic services retention - Chegg said Chegg Study monthly retention remained strong, reinforcing its long-term cash-generating potential.
Quarterly results and drivers
Chegg said Q2 revenue fell 51% year over year, but exceeded company expectations. Adjusted EBITDA was positive, reflecting disciplined expense management and AI-driven efficiencies.
The company repurchased $1.7 million in shares during Q2, with $120.7 million remaining authorized.
